The Role

This is a leadership opportunity for an experienced Private Client solicitor to take ownership of a growing department. Currently a small team, the practice has a strong platform and clear appetite for expansion. You will manage complex probate, estates, trusts and Court of Protection work, while setting the strategic direction of the department.

Alongside fee-earning, you will mentor and develop the team, grow Court of Protection services, and play a visible role in business development. This is a role with genuine influence and long-term potential. Why this role?
